Where The Glass Glows: Unpacking The Therapeutic Experiences Of Adult Students In A Community-Based Open Glass Studio During A Pandemic, Shelly A. Palmer Jan 2021

Where The Glass Glows: Unpacking The Therapeutic Experiences Of Adult Students In A Community-Based Open Glass Studio During A Pandemic, Shelly A. Palmer

Art Therapy | Electronic Master's Theses 2015 - 2021

This qualitative study used categorizing and theming analysis to learn about how adult students of stained glass and makers of stained glass in a community-based open glass studio understand their experience of working with glass during the CO VID-19 pandemic. The aim of this study was to acquire an understanding about how working with glass was therapeutic during a pandemic. Open-ended surveys were used to understand the experiences of glass makers (n = 11) and students in a stained-glass studio (n = 26) and their responses were thematically categorized.
